What Happened
On the evening of July 8th, Chicago experienced an unprecedented extreme weather event where over five inches of rain fell in just 90 minutes, surpassing the city's average monthly rainfall. The intense stationary thunderstorms caused widespread flooding, including flooded viaducts and basements, with emergency water rescues taking place in multiple locations, especially on the city's west side. This flooding event is part of a pattern seen recently in other parts of the US with multiple severe flood incidents reported within the same week, including catastrophic floods in Texas and New Mexico with significant casualties.
